Approximated Costs of Private Mental Health Diagnosis
Protecting a mental health diagnosis through Private Mental Health Assessment Ireland healthcare comes with associated costs. Below is a table reflecting average expenses that clients can expect:
ServiceTypical Cost (₤)Initial Consultation150 - 300Psychological Assessment300 - 600Follow-up Sessions90 - 150 per sessionMedication (if applicable)Varies (on prescription)Therapy sessions50 - 120 per session
Costs can vary considerably based upon place, the expert's experience, and the intricacy of the case.
Advantages of a Private Diagnosis
Lowered Waiting Times: Private healthcare eliminates long waiting lists typical in the NHS.

Individualized Attention: You frequently get one-on-one time with your clinician, permitting for a more customized and responsive method to treatment.

Flexible Scheduling: Private professionals often provide versatile appointment times, accommodating your schedule.

Larger Range of Services: Access to varied treatment choices that may not be offered through the NHS.
